GammaAI 2025


Welcome to the GammaAI 2025 page of GammaWiki.

Here you will find information about the upcoming GammaAI 2025 seminar on gamma-ray spectrometry, taking place at DTU Lyngby Campus, Denmark, from October 8 to 9, 2025.

The seminar will introduce essential concepts of artificial intelligence (AI), aiming to emphasize potential practical applications within gamma-ray spectrometry. A dedicated session will provide introductory lessons on AI.
GammaAI 2025 will also cover a broad range of topics related to gamma-ray spectrometry. The seminar's scope is intentionally wide, allowing discussions on various relevant areas. The following areas may be included (but are not limited to):

  • Laboratory, in situ, and mobile measurements
  • Whole body measurements
  • Uncertainty calculations
  • Efficiency determination
  • Spectrum analysis and data management
  • Monte Carlo simulations
  • Nuclear forensics
  • Novel approaches
  • Applications


Participants are encouraged to join the data analysis intercomparison exercise using a soil sample (available here) and complete a survey regarding the lowest background levels they have achieved (available here).

Overview and background

This work is supported by the Nordic Nuclear Safety Research (NKS). GammaWiki is a resource webpage for Nordic users of gamma spectrometry. GammaWiki is a product of the NKS GammaSpec 2016 activity, which is an independent continuation of the GammaUser (2014), GammaTest (2013), GammaWorkshop (2011-2012), and GammaSem (2009) activities.
GammaAI 2025 is the twelfth event in the series of gamma-ray spectrometry seminars. A page with links to individual information pages for previous seminars can be accessed here.

Data Analysis Intercomparison

There is an opportunity for those interested to participate in a data analysis intercomparison exercise.
Participants are asked to analyze the provided spectrum and send the activities of the identified radionuclides in a natural soil sample.
Instructions and all necessary data can be previewed and downloaded here. The files are compressed into a 7z archive. To extract all the files, you can use 7zip link.
